Google Indexed Pages Checker
The Google Indexed Pages Checker is an excellent tool that can help developers to determine how many of their web pages have been indexed by Google. This is extremely beneficial for SEO and can help determine whether or not pages that were submitted were actually listed. If you are using a paid submission service, this is an excellent way to check on your results. It is important to know that not every page will be indexed by Google. Some pages take longer to be indexed than others depending on various factors. It is important to create a clean, regularly updated and relevant website if you want to get your pages listed on Google. There are things you can do to increase the potential for your web pages to get indexed. One way is to add a blog to your website as this type of content is regularly updated, getting the attention of the Google bots. Another way is to increase the number of backlinks to your website from other outside websites. You can trade links with relevant sites, join forums and use a signature line that links to your website or post comments on relevant blogs. Search Engine Saturation Checker
Want to know if your pages are getting indexed? The search engine saturation checker tells you how many pages are making it into the search engines at all. Unlike some of the other tools available, this one tells how how many pages are indexed in all three major search engines: Google, Bing, and Yahoo. Why is it important to know whether or not your pages are being indexed? Many people assume that the search engines aren't bringing in traffic because they don't rank well in the search engines. While this is true in some cases, there are actually many cases in which the search engine doesn't even know the page exists. This tool lets you know whether or not your strategy is allowing your pages to be discovered by the search engines. By comparing the actual number of pages on your site to the number of pages indexed, you may be surprised how many of them the search engines don't even know about. Another context in which the tool can be useful is if you experience a sudden loss of traffic to your site. If this happens, you may want to check to see if your pages have been removed from the index. This can happen in some cases if your site is penalized. Ultimately, the tool lets you know whether the search engines are even aware of all of your content.

Site Spider Viewer
Ever wonder how your web pages look to search engine spiders? The Site Spider Viewer lets you have a spider's eye view of your website, giving you insight into issues that might be preventing your pages from getting the rank they deserve. Developers can then take the resulting data and make changes as needed to improve their page's optimization within the search engines. This SEO tool will give you a full and detailed report of any issues that would get picked up by a search engine spider. Elements such as meta tags, keywords, text content character length, site title and much more are all carefully and quickly checked. The data is stripped from your web page's HTML source code and is then organized for quick review. Spotting out mistakes, such as meta tags that are improperly formatted, title tags that are too long or missed SEO opportunities such as alt tags or proper keyword density, will help you to create a better web page. Pages that are correctly formatted and optimized will receive a much higher ranking in the popular search engines than websites that don't pay attention to their SEO. After all, if you want your target audience to find your website, a high search engine rank for relevant keywords and phrases should be a top priority.

In addition to SEO work, there are a number of things you can do to increase the chances that your web page will get indexed by Yahoo! Fresh content, new articles and blog posts are a great way to get Yahoo's attention. This is particularly true of a website that is already well-established, as the major search engines will be checking your website regularly for updates. New websites can take longer for these pages to be indexed. Basic, straight-forward SEO work is the real key to getting your website indexed by Yahoo. Make sure your pages load quickly, feature proper HTML markup and that your keywords, content and site theme are relevant to each other.
